tibberous Posted September 1, 2008 Share Posted September 1, 2008 I am trying to get Apache to act as a web server on CentOS 5. If I change the Listen line in the httpd.conf file to anything but a local ip, I get the error: Could not assign the requested address: make_sock: could not bind to address Is this maybe just a problem because I am using a router? Like, I could go to a colocation, get a static ip, and be good? ratcateme Posted September 1, 2008 Share Posted September 1, 2008 this is a PHP forum and this has nothing to do with PHP you need to set it to your local IP then configure port forwarding on your router Scott.
